How did the distruction of bison herds impact Native Americans?
Zielflug [23.3K]

The Plains Indians were almost totally dependent upon the bison. They were a source of food, shelter, utensils, and clothing and most importantly spiritual strength. The American bison sacrificed its life to keep the American Indian in existence.

What is the tallest building in the world and where is it located?
BlackZzzverrR [31]

The Burj Khalifa building also known as Burj Dubai is the tallest building in the world. Designed by Adrian Smith, it rises 828 meters above the city of Dubai in the United Arab Emirates.
